The US global 10% import surcharge under Section 122 of the Trade Act of 1974 is capped by statute at 150 days (effective February 24, 2026; expiry July 24, 2026). An extension requires a separate Act of Congress. As of July 18, 2026, no extension bill has advanced; the bipartisan 'Reclaim Trade Powers Act' moves in the opposite direction. The Trump administration is already pivoting to Section 301 mechanisms (blanket 12.5% on 46 countries) as the successor tool. Samsung officially confirmed Galaxy Unpacked for July 22, 2026 (2 PM BST, London). SamMobile explicitly names the Galaxy Z Flip 8 and Galaxy Z Fold 8 as headline announcements; livestream via Samsung YouTube. The Z Flip 8 is a direct iterative successor to the Z Flip 7 in clamshell form factor, expected to feature a 6.9-inch inner AMOLED, 4.1-inch cover display, and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 5 (US). Starting price expected ~$1,200, with availability around early August 2026.
